Les Itinérantes, a Cappella Trio

“Three enchantresses, as if escaped from a not-so-distant Brocéliande…”
Natalie Dessay & Laurent Naouri, opera singers

Les Itinérantes, a unique female vocal trio, draws its strength from the diversity of its repertoire. Supported by original arrangements, the three singers perform a cappella songs from all eras in over thirty different languages, journeying through styles, time, and space.

Manon Cousin, Pauline Langlois de Swarte, and Elodie Pont craft a sound with multiple personalities to adorn the various musical stories they tell. Gentle, powerful, celestial, or earthy, their voices meet, blending forgotten tales with original compositions, in languages sometimes lost or invented, on a journey where eras intertwine and borders dissipate.

Three musicians with distinct backgrounds who have brought together their diverse influences – from early music to French chanson – to illustrate themes dear to them: women, nature, travel, and imagination.

Reis Glorios

“Reis Glorios” is a medieval alba in Occitan, by the troubadour Guiraud de Bornelh (12th/13th century), arranged by Pauline Langlois de Swarte.

Glorious King, true light and clarity,
Be a faithful aid to my companion
Whom I have not seen since dusk
For soon the dawn will come.
